Creating healthy relationships in all areas of our life is the focus of this season of Unlimited. A relationship is how we relate to another person, place, thing, or even concept. How we relate to ourselves is at the core of how we relate to others. Yet, how we understand and relate to ourselves is also built from those external relationships. Unfortunately, most of us haven’t been taught how to cultivate healthy relationships let alone experienced examples of them. In many cases we need to first unlearn harmful ways of relating before we can learn healing ways of relating. First, we’ll lay a foundation of understanding healthy and unhealthy relating. Then, over the next several months, we’ll explore how it applies to all areas of our life.

In this episode of Unlimited, I’m kicking off the focus of season 4 by setting a foundation for creating healthy relationships.

Some of what I’ll cover in this episode include:

  • Understanding relationships beyond the interpersonal
  • Qualities of healthy relationships like trust, honesty, communication, and self-awareness
  • Relationship red flags like control, disrespect, imbalances, and hurtful language
  • Building self-trust and growing through conflict
  • What to expect in Season 4 of Unlimited
